系统日志记录了计算机系统中发生的各种事件,包括系统错误、警告信息、运行状况等,备份系统日志是维护系统安全和故障排查的重要步骤,以下是如何备份系统日志的详细介绍:
Windows系统日志备份
在Windows操作系统中,可以通过事件查看器来访问和备份日志。
1、打开“事件查看器”:
按下Win + R
键,输入eventvwr.msc
并回车。
2、选择日志类型:
在事件查看器中,您会看到多种类型的日志,如应用程序、安全、系统等。
3、导出日志:
右键点击想要备份的日志类型,选择“保存所有事件为…”。
在弹出的文件保存对话框中,选择保存路径和文件名,通常保存为.evtx
格式。
4、定期备份设置:
可以通过创建计划任务来定期自动备份日志。
Linux系统日志备份
Linux系统的日志通常存储在/var/log
目录下,不同类型的服务和应用会有各自的日志文件。
1、手动备份:
使用cp
或rsync
命令将日志文件复制到备份目录。
cp /var/log/syslog /path/to/backup/syslog_date
2、使用logrotate
工具:
logrotate
是一个用于管理日志文件的工具,可以自动轮换、压缩、删除和邮件日志文件。
编辑/etc/logrotate.conf
或创建新的配置文件,指定日志文件的轮换规则。
3、定时任务:
利用cron
设置定时任务,定期执行备份脚本。
macOS系统日志备份
macOS的系统日志位于/var/log
目录,可以使用log show
命令查看。
1、手动备份:
打开终端,使用cp
命令备份日志文件。
cp /var/log/system.log /path/to/backup/system_date.log
2、使用asl
工具:
asl
是macOS下用于查询和操作日志的工具。
使用asl collect
命令收集日志,然后将其导出到指定位置。
日志分析与监控
备份日志后,可以使用文本编辑器或专业的日志分析工具来检查和分析日志内容,这有助于及时发现系统问题和安全威胁。
相关问题与解答
Q1: 如何定期自动备份Windows系统日志?
A1: 可以通过创建计划任务来实现定期自动备份,在任务计划程序中创建一个新任务,设置触发器为定期执行,操作为导出日志的命令。
Q2: Linux下的logrotate
是如何工作的?
A2: logrotate
根据配置文件中的规则,对日志文件进行轮转、压缩和删除,每次轮转时,它会重新命名旧的日志文件,并创建一个新的日志文件供服务使用。
Q3: macOS系统中如何查看系统日志?
A3: 可以使用log show
命令或者打开“控制台”应用来查看系统日志。
Q4: 如果日志文件很大,备份时应该注意什么?
A4: 如果日志文件很大,备份时应该考虑磁盘空间和使用压缩工具来减少存储需求,定期清理和归档旧的日志文件也很重要。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/569956.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复